Not the Best of Days

Summary:

Lou and Kid get into a fight, Lou finishes it

Work Text:

They had been outside arguing for some time and things were getting pretty heated when Lou, fed up and tired, said, “Enough Kid! We've been through this a hundred times and I'm done fighting about it!” and turned to go.
Kid snapped. “NO! You're my wife and you WILL do what I say!” He grabbed her arm, swung her around and without thinking, slapped her!

Lou's hand went to her face, her eyes wide as she stumbled two steps backwards and fell to the ground, stunned, 'He hit me!'
Kid, realizing he'd just made a terrible mistake and his anger abated, took a step forward with his arms out, “Lou! I'm sorry..”
Hickok's coaching paid off. Quick as a thought, Lou's revolver had appeared in her hand and Kid found himself staring down at the business end of her gun, “Back. Off.”

Kid took a step forward, “Lou you wouldn't..” A loud BANG! And Kid felt a bullet fly past his left ear. He froze.
Lou cocked the gun again, “I said BACK OFF.” She was still holding her cheek where he'd stuck her but she was no longer in shock, she was furious!
Kid tried again, “Lou please!” Another loud BANG! and Kid felt a bullet buzz past his right ear.
Lou cocked the hammer back, “Next one goes right down the middle.”

Kid stepped back as she got to her feet, “You got ten seconds to get on your horse and ride out or so help me God Kid I'll put one of these in you.”
Kid took another step back, “Lou please! I'm sorry!”
“You're gonna be sorry alright. No one hits me. NO ONE!”
Kid's shoulders slumped as resigned and defeated he turned to go, 'What have I done?' He walked over to Katie and mounted her. He looked back at Lou who still had the gun leveled at him, “Lou please, I'm sorry, I really am. I didn't mean it.”
Lou just stared at him over the sights of her gun and said very coldly and calmly, “Five”. He knew it was useless to continue and nudged Katie to move off.

Lou watched as Kid rode away and slid her pistol back into its holster. Her knees had started to shake but she stayed standing until he was out of sight. Then her legs gave way and she crumpled to the ground as the tears came.
